LOVE SOCKS MOVIE NOMINATED FOR BEST COMEDY AWARD IN THE USA AT THE NYCIFF 2015

“LOVE SOCKS” has been nominated for the “BEST COMEDY AWARD” at the New York City International Film Festival!

Congratulations to the entire “LOVE SOCKS MOVIE” team!

The film is competing in the BEST COMEDY category with the following films: “HOW TO MURDER YOUR WIFE” (NZ) directed by Ricardo Pellizzeri (Wolf Creek, Underbelly, Home and Away, Neighbours, Little Oberon) starring Todd Lasance, William Kircher, Mark Mitchinson, Holly Shanahan, Geraldine Brophy; and “WON KA WAN” (CHINA).

LOVE SOCKS MOVIE SYNOPSIS

LOVE SOCKS is a heart-warming story about love, family, friends and bodily function anomalies!

It’s a romantic comedy that follows the story of Frederica. As a child she is diagnosed with a phenomenon known as Raynaud’s, which in her case means she will sneeze forever. Frederica discovers her only respite from this affliction is to wear socks to provide warm to her extremely cold feet. The film exposes the heartaches that ensue when she loses her socks and how her insecurities affect and jeopardize her relationships.

Ultimately, LOVE SOCKS is about letting go of our fears, those inner voices holding us back from opportunities and embracing life and happiness.

The film stars a stellar Australian cast, including Michele Mattiuzzi (Home & Away), Shailla Quadra (Dealing With Destiny), Natalie Rose (The Makeover), Khanh Trieu (Fat Pizza), Olga Markovic (Deadly Woman), Amber Gokken (Gabriel), and many more!

Cinematography by Jack Kelly (Other World) and Marc Stimson (LARP), and a beautiful international soundtrack with some of the best voices from Australia & Brazil, including Snez, Sally Street, Daniel Fontes, Mano Tales, DJ Doido and many more!

LOVE SOCKS is the first feature film as a Writer-Producer-Director-Actress for the film creator Shailla Quadra.

LOVE SOCKS is partly based on true events.

ABOUT THE NYCIFF

The 8th edition of the New York City International Film Festival opened on the 30th of April 2015, and it will go until the 7th of May 2015, screening a selection of some of the best movies from around the world, including “Phantom Halo” Directed by Antonia Bogdanovich, Starring Rebecca Romijn & Thomas Brodie-Sangster; “William Shatner Presents: Chaos on the Bridge” Directed by William Shatner, Starring William Shatner & Patrick Stewart; “The Emerging Past Directors Cut’ Directed by Thomas J Churchill, Starring Stephen Geoffreys & Tony Moran; “Greencard Warriors” Directed by Miriam Kruishoop, Starring Manny Perez & Vivica A Fox; and many more worldwide movies!
